I've been officially collecting these since December 2009, and as of now I currently have 158 cars, and 151 of those are actually licensed ones (I focus on those for collecting). Some possibly interesting details of my collection are that I have 19 Speed Machines (2010 series), 4 2011 HW Garage, 1 Vintage Racing, 4 IndyCar Series (2 from 2009, 2 from 2011), and 1 Ferrari Racer edition cars. The rest are either mainline HW/MB, or Greenlight 1:64 (Motor World/Hot Pursuit Series), as well as a Shelby Collectibles '10 GT500.

Japanese Nostalgic CarThe list thus far includes new castings such as the 1985 Honda CR-X, Subaru BRAT, Plymouth Arrow (Mitsubishi Lancer Celeste) Funny Car, 87 Toyota (which is likely a pickup), 85 Yamaha V-Max, and a retool of the original A60 82 Supra
